Valerie Sweeting (Edmonton, AB) finished 4-3 in the 0-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Sweeting defeated
Delia DeJong (Sexsmith, AB) 8-6, then won 8-6 against Laura Crocker (Edmonton, AB) and 7-6 against Tiffany Game (Edmonton, AB). Sweeting went on to lose 9-7 against Renee Sonnenberg (Grande Prairie, AB). Sweeting responded with a 6-4 win over Shannon Kleibrink (Calgary, AB). Sweeting went on to lose 7-4 against Crocker. Sweeting lost 8-7 to Kristie Moore (Grande Prairie, AB) in their final qualifying round match.
 
. For week 24 of the event schedule, Sweeting did not improve upon their best events, remaining at 19th place on the World Ranking Standings with 113.795 total points. Sweeting ranks 18th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 66.905 points earned so far this season.
